The Basics of Currency Conversion

What Is Currency Conversion?

Currency conversion is the process of exchanging one currency for another based on the current exchange rate. Exchange rates fluctuate due to various factors, including economic conditions, political stability, and market speculation.

Why Exchange Rates Matter

Exchange rates determine the value of one currency relative to another. For example, if 1 AUD equals 0.55 GBP, then 60 AUD would be worth 33 GBP. These rates impact international trade, travel costs, and investment returns.

How to Convert 60 AUD to GBP

To convert 60 AUD to GBP, use the formula:

Amount in GBP=Amount in AUD×Exchange Rate

If the exchange rate is 0.55, then:

60 AUD×0.55=33 GBP

Factors Influencing Exchange Rates

1. Economic Indicators

Economic indicators such as inflation rates, interest rates, and gross domestic product (GDP) growth influence exchange rates. Strong economic performance generally leads to a stronger currency.

Inflation: Lower inflation typically strengthens a currency.

Interest Rates: Higher interest rates attract foreign investment, boosting currency value.

GDP Growth: A growing economy signals strength, potentially increasing currency demand.

2. Political Stability and Economic Performance

Political stability and economic performance are crucial for currency strength. Countries with stable governments and strong economies tend to have stronger currencies.

Political Stability: Investors prefer stable countries, leading to stronger currencies.

Economic Performance: Economic growth attracts investment, boosting currency value.

3. Market Speculation

Currency values can be influenced by speculation. Traders buying or selling currencies based on expected economic events can cause fluctuations.

Speculative Trading: Large-scale currency trades based on speculation can impact exchange rates.

Market Sentiment: Perceptions of future economic conditions influence currency values.

4. Supply and Demand

Like any commodity, currency values are influenced by supply and demand. Higher demand for a currency increases its value, while higher supply decreases it.

Demand for Currency: Higher demand from investors and traders strengthens currency.

Currency Supply: Central banks influence supply through monetary policies.

Real-World Example: Converting 60 AUD to GBP

Step-by-Step Conversion

Check the Current Exchange Rate: Use an online converter or financial news source to find the current rate. For this example, the current exchange rate is 0.53 GBP per AUD.

Apply the Formula: Multiply 60 AUD by 0.53 to get 31 GBP.

Consider Fees: If using a service, factor in any fees that may reduce the final amount received.
